The Bainbridge Probation Substance Abuse Center is settled in Bainbridge, Georgia. The Correctional Center is classified as what is known as a medium-security jail.
The Bainbridge Probation Substance Abuse Center rehabilitates their prisoners through their numerous projects. These projects incorporate, however are not restricted to the accompanying:

In contrast to other state offices, the Bainbridge Probation Substance Abuse Center as of now doesn't have their database brimming with detainees open to the general population.
Regardless of whether you are attempting to find or discover more data about a prisoner, you should contact the Correctional Center legitimately at the number given. While reaching the Correctional Center, you should in any event have the prisoners complete name and their date of birth convenient.

Phone calls
You won't be allowed to contact a guilty party by means of phone nor will you be allowed to leave them a message. You will be required to trust that a guilty party will get in touch with you by means of phone.
Detainees will be allowed to utilize the telephone. Ordinarily, telephones will be accessible during the daytime hours if the Bainbridge Probation Substance Abuse Center isn't under a lockdown.
Calls might be allowed to be 15-minutes long.
Visitation
Guests are very free to visit a detainee at the Bainbridge Probation Substance Abuse Center during the select days.
Nonetheless, before you can visit a detainee, you will be required to round out the Georgia Prisoner Guests Application. This application should be rounded out, submitted, and endorsed, preceding you being allowed to come in and visit with a detainee.
Visiting Hours
Saturday — 9:00 AM to 3:00 PM
Sunday — 9:00 AM to 3:00 PM
